English verb: abdicate

1. abdicate (social) give up, such as power, as of monarchs and emperors, or duties and obligations


SamplesThe King abdicated when he married a divorcee.


Synonymsrenounce


Pattern of useSomebody ----s


Broader (hypernym)give up, renounce, resign, vacate
